How they compare

Republic of Moldova currently reports 10.9% against 9.6% in Syrian Arab Republic, a difference of 1.3%.

That makes Republic of Moldova's figure about 1.1 times Syrian Arab Republic's.

Across all 11 years both countries report, Republic of Moldova has been ahead every year.

Republic of Moldova ranks 72nd and Syrian Arab Republic ranks 75th of 144 countries.

Republic of Moldova has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Republic of Moldova Syrian Arab Republic Difference Ahead
1960s 5.3% 0.1% 5.2% Republic of Moldova
1970s 6.7% 0.1% 6.5% Republic of Moldova
1980s 8.2% 0.4% 7.8% Republic of Moldova
1990s 11.6% 1.2% 10.5% Republic of Moldova
2000s 17.4% 5.6% 11.8% Republic of Moldova
2010s 10.9% 9.6% 1.3% Republic of Moldova

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
